Transaction 02525620d4d76567d15751fe58393e6017618964a4141c76bc49bae299919d63
1 Input
2 Outputs
- 02525620d4d76567d15751fe58393e6017618964a4141c76bc49bae299919d63:0
- 02525620d4d76567d15751fe58393e6017618964a4141c76bc49bae299919d63:1
value 5679512
address 37yCCBAieEFTnBvMdK3RgQpSovu5v7k7Vu
value 6277396
address 38JqZ4omhJrcWawZP9jY9JofE3qCdgeiVJ